Rice (Oryza sativa L.) is the most important staple food consumed by more than sixty per cent of the world population. In south Gujarat, rice crop is cultivated during kharif as well as in summer season. Rice seeds after harvesting are stored for next year; the seed-infecting fungi are one of the important constraints for the rice seeds during storage. Infected seeds germinate poorly and could be a major source of inoculum for new crops raised from them.studied in the association of seed mycoflora during storage and its effect on germination, vigour index with different packaging materials and seed treatments on popular varieties of rice.The seeds samples of five rice varieties, GR-4, GNR-3, GNR-4, Gurjari and NAUR-1 were used to know the association of seed mycoflora on the seeds of popular varieties of rice during the short term storage.

Polymeric gel systems have been widely used for excessive water management in recent years for enhanced oil recovery applications These gels have been proved useful for profile control and reducing excess water production from hydrocarbon-bearing reservoirs. There are three common methods to improve water shut-off performance, which are increasing the viscosity of the flooding fluid, reducing the permeability of high-permeability streaks present in the reservoir and increasing the permeability of low-permeable zones. Among all water control processes, chemical water shut-off treatment is one which has shown its feasibility and practicality in oilfields for decades. Polymeric gel systems are usually composed of a water-soluble polymer or monomer crosslinked with an organic or inorganic crosslinker.
